Loudoun County vs Vienna: How they compare

Loudoun County spans the Dulles Airport tech corridor, the Silver Line Metro extension (Ashburn, Loudoun Gateway), and western wine country (Leesburg, Purcellville, Middleburg). Vienna offers a small-town atmosphere with big-city proximity, the W&OD Trail, downtown shops, and address-based Fairfax County Public Schools assignments. The details differ. Market Overview

Vienna is pricier ($960K median vs $620K), a difference of about $340K. Vienna moves faster, with homes averaging 12 days on market compared to 16 in Loudoun County. Loudoun County offers a lower entry point at $300K–$10M+.

Is Loudoun County or Vienna more affordable?

Loudoun County is more affordable with a median home price of $620K, compared to $960K in Vienna. Both cities offer a wide range of housing options, from condos and townhomes to single-family homes. Loudoun County prices range from $300K–$10M+. Vienna prices range from $500K–$2.5M.
